Addiction treatment works to help the individual understand what leads to continued drug abuse and addiction, helping the person to identify and manage the triggers that lead to cravings and, ultimately, avoid relapse to drug use. In other cases, people start abusing medication not prescribed for them in order to experience a high, relieve tension, increase alertness, or improve concentration. In fact, teens are more likely to abuse prescription and over-the-counter drugs, including painkillers, stimulants, sedatives, and tranquilizers.
